Premier League

In yet another bid to entice William Saliba from Arsenal, Real Madrid are prepared to propose Rodrygo to the Gunners in a direct exchange, DefensaCentral reports.
Chelsea are also believed to maintain interest in Rodrygo, though Liverpool and Tottenham Hotspur are described as more serious contenders, according to Ben Jacobs.
Tottenham have been suggested by GIVEMESPORT to launch an unexpected pursuit of Manchester City winger Savinho.
Recently released Manchester United playmaker Christian Eriksen has been linked as a target for newly promoted Burnley, the Daily Mail reports.
Arsenal have altered their strategy, TBR Football reports, and are ready to present Jakub Kiwior with a fresh contract this summer.
Manchester United's subsequent priority following the completion of Benjamin Šeško's signing is expected to be securing Fiorentina's Pietro Comuzzo, Nicolò Schira has disclosed.
Newcastle United target Yoanne Wissa has been brought back into Brentford's training sessions but continues to seek a summer departure, BBC Sport reports.
Darwin Núñez is anticipated to receive higher wages than Mohamed Salah upon signing his Al Hilal deal valued at up to $25 million annually, as per Sacha Tavolieri.
West Ham United are exploring a potential move for Metz prospect Idrissa Gueye, Foot Mercato states. Manchester United and Borussia Dortmund are also believed to be tracking the Senegal international who is projected to cost around €15 million ($17.5 million).
La Liga

Real Madrid have received a €130 million ($150.6 million) valuation from Paris Saint-Germain following their inquiry about Vitinha, according to Foot01.
Amid escalating friction between Barcelona and Marc-André ter Stegen, Paris Saint-Germain are reportedly circling with interest, prepared to acquire the unsettled German keeper as stated by Fichajes.
Aston Villa have increased their bid for Ferran Torres to €50 million ($58.2 million) but Barcelona are hesitant to part with a player Hansi Flick appreciates, El Nacional suggests.
Rangers and Sevilla are vying for Arsenal backup goalkeeper Karl Hein's services, according to Dominik Schneider.
Real Madrid are pursuing Bayern Munich defender Dayot Upamecano on a free transfer when his deal concludes in 2026, Fichajes reports.
